Transaction 1d90771b4140c75bfd10403a72a75d829861688dba87ef54e7a7c68c16c62113
1 Input
1 Output
-
1d90771b4140c75bfd10403a72a75d829861688dba87ef54e7a7c68c16c62113:0
- value
- 630769967
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ed58d2d79d67c16835e4aa6a8b103366e6baf48d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NdyZ35o176UjXzEiNHrMjz8wq2hFQ5jaz